I stayed with my partner at The Lamb at Hindon on a cold Friday night in April 2006. Hindon itself is a pretty little village and The Lamb was warm and welcoming. The rooms are basic but clean and perfectly acceptable. Dinner was very nice too.

We loved our night at the Lamb – everything a traditional English country coaching inn should be, full of a gracious, relaxed charm and exuding character. We were doubly pleased to find that this did not mean it was unduly precious – the bar (yes, there still was one, despite an emphasis on food, which can be eaten in style in the restaurant or at mellow leisure in the bar) was full of locals, with a good atmosphere. The food was very good and we were allowed to bring our dog with us to bedroom and bar meal, which was greatly appreciated. The Argentinian Malbec was just the thing, and reasonably priced. Service was spot on. We can’t wait to get back for a long weekend to explore this wonderful area and soak up more of the Lamb’s atmosphere.
